Text excerpt from page 13 (click to view)
Safety cut-out
Cooking surface
� If after switching on the cooking surface, a heat setting is not set for a cooking zone within approx. 10 seconds, the cooking surface automatically switches itself off. � If one or more sensor fields are covered by objects (a pan, cloths, etc.) for longer than approx. 10 seconds, a signal sounds and the cooking surface switches off automatically. � If all cooking zones are switched off, the cooking surface automatically switches itself off after approx. 10 seconds.
Control panel
� When the appliance is switched off, if one or more of the sensor fields on the control panel are covered for more that 10 seconds, an acoustic signal sounds. The acoustic signal switches itself off automatically when the sensor fields are no longer covered.
Induction cooking zones
� In the event of overheating (e.g. when a pan boils dry) the cooking zone automatically switches itself off. is displayed. Before being used again, the cooking zone must be set to 0 and allowed to cool down. � If cookware that is not suitable is used, flashes in the display and after 2 minutes the display for the cooking zone switches itself off. � If one of the cooking zones is not switched off after a certain time, or if the heat setting is not modified, the relevant cooking zone switches off automatically. is displayed. Before being used again, the cooking zone must be set to 0. Heat setting V, 1 - 2 3-4 5 6-9 Switches off after 6 hours 5 hours 4 hours 1.5 hours
